Transaction 19238386d29f9557771947f029c95dee0475a9aa75d12bea914857f7f1792419

69 Input
2 Outputs
  • 19238386d29f9557771947f029c95dee0475a9aa75d12bea914857f7f1792419:0
  • value  987041
    address  3BVC9SsVQQ6vTgDSyUmSn9GniZJAxdtTqy
  • 19238386d29f9557771947f029c95dee0475a9aa75d12bea914857f7f1792419:1
  • value  4436019842
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s